Solution Overview

Problem

Existing settlement systems have low convenience as they output paper or electronic receipts based on pre-set information for each customer, limiting flexibility and user experience.

Innovation Solution

A settlement system comprising a receipt printer, an information processing device, and terminal devices that communicate to generate and transmit printing data, image data, and selection information, allowing for the selection and output of either electronic or paper receipts based on customer preference.

PatentUS20250053948A1Settlement system, receipt system, and method of controlling receipt system
Publication Date: 2025.02.13 SEIKO EPSON CORP

AI summary

A settlement system is a settlement system including a receipt printer, an information processing device, a first terminal device, a second terminal device, and a third terminal device. The first terminal device generates printing data and transmits the printing data to the receipt printer. The receipt printer transmits the received printing data to the information processing device. The information processing device generates image data based on the received printing data and transmits the image data to the second terminal device. The second terminal device displays the received image data and transmits first selection information to the information processing device when an electronic receipt has been selected. The information processing device determines, based on the received first selection information, that the electronic receipt has been selected and generates electronic receipt information and transmits the electronic receipt information when receiving an electronic receipt request from the third terminal device.
